Incarnate Word Academy High School

Incarnate Word Academy High School serves 320 students in grades 9-12.
The student:teacher of Incarnate Word Academy High School is 10:1 and the school's religious affiliation is Catholic.

In what neighborhood is Incarnate Word Academy High School located?
Incarnate Word Academy High School is located in the Bay Area neighborhood of Corpus Christi, TX. There are 7 other private schools located in Bay Area.
